DATE : 01 FEBRUARY 2024 P.C. :- At the outset the learned Counsel for the Respondents points out that the Petitioner has a remedy of filing an appeal and this specific stand is taken by the Respondents specifying the provisions under which the appeal lies under the Bombay Port Trust Employees Regulations.
2.
The learned Counsel for the Petitioner states that the Petitioner will prefer an appeal however some time limit be provided for disposal of the appeal. If the Petitioner files an appeal within a period of four weeks from today, the Respondent - Appellate
16. WP 14388.18.doc Authority will make an endevour to dispose of the appeal within a period of three months from the date of institution, subject to earlier pressing public duties.
3.
Keeping contentions of the parties open, we dispose of the Petition.
